The Benefits of Gouda and Butternut Squash
Gouda cheese, originating from the Netherlands, is known for its smooth texture and mild, nutty flavor. It melts beautifully, making it ideal for baked dishes. Butternut squash is a versatile vegetable packed with vitamins, fiber, and antioxidants. When roasted, it develops a caramelized sweetness that complements the savory cheese perfectly.
Preparing the Dish
To create this cozy dish, start by roasting the butternut squash. Peel and cube the squash, then toss it with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Roast in a preheated oven at 400°F (200°C) for about 25-30 minutes until tender and caramelized.
While the squash is roasting, grate or slice the Gouda cheese. Once the squash is ready, transfer it to an oven-safe dish, sprinkle the cheese over the top, and bake for an additional 10 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
